What color is E7DBBF?
The RGB color code for color number #E7DBBF is RGB(231, 219, 191). In the RGB color model, #E7DBBF has a red value of 231, a green value of 219, and a blue value of 191.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 5.2% magenta, 17.3% yellow, and 9.4%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 42° (degrees), 45.5 % saturation, and 82.7 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#E7DBBF has a hue of 42° (degrees), 17.3 % saturation and 90.6 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of E7DBBF?
Color code E7DBBF has an LRV of nearly 71.
By LRV value, it is a light color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.
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.
The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el
The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
